Transaction 42768e2fcfa515b58303218a7671659b5605751ad694b517642253728d0a30f2

1 Input
2 Outputs
  • 42768e2fcfa515b58303218a7671659b5605751ad694b517642253728d0a30f2:0
  • value  34549396673
    address  tb1q3uzrguh27pgaqjh9kmsf97gfuuaz8nkl3gz3p3
  • 42768e2fcfa515b58303218a7671659b5605751ad694b517642253728d0a30f2:1
  • value  50000
    address  tb1qeff5z93t673ssfzk6havwq0a3e4t97hxs9qyn4